Barn ro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of structure and installing a new one to ensure the property's protection and structural integrity. This process typically includes assessing the current roof's condition, removing damaged or aging materials, and installing new roofing components such as shingles, underlayment, and flashing. Professionals ensure that the new roof is properly fitted and sealed to withstand weather elements and provide long-lasting performance. These services are essential when a roof has reached the end of its lifespan or has suffered significant damage from storms, leaks, or other issues.
Replacing a barn roof addresses several common problems, including leaks, wood rot, and compromised structural support. Over time, exposure to moisture, temperature fluctuations, and pests can weaken roofing materials, leading to potential water intrusion and internal damage. A new roof helps prevent further deterioration, reduces the risk of interior damage, and maintains the overall stability of the structure. This service is particularly valuable for properties where the roof's condition impacts the safety and usability of the building, such as barns used for storage, livestock, or equipment.

Cost of Barn Roof Replacement - The typical cost range for replacing a barn roof varies between $3,000 and $8,000, depending on the size and materials used. Smaller structures may be closer to the lower end, while larger barns with premium materials can reach the higher end of the spectrum.
Material Options and Costs - The choice of roofing material impacts the overall cost, with asphalt shingles costing around $2 to $4 per square foot, and metal roofing ranging from $5 to $12 per square foot. The total expense will depend on the barn’s square footage and material preferences.
Labor and Installation Expenses - Labor costs for barn roof replacement typically range from $1,500 to $4,000, influenced by the roof’s complexity and accessibility. Professional installation ensures proper fitting and durability, which can affect overall costs.
Additional Cost Factors - Costs may increase with necessary repairs to underlying structures or if special permits are required. It’s recommended to contact local contractors for accurate estimates tailored to specific barn sizes and con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should barn roofs be replaced? The lifespan of a barn roof varies based on materials and environmental conditions, but replacement is typically considered when signs of significant damage or deterioration appear.
What types of roofing materials are available for barn roof replacements? Common options include metal, asphalt shingles, wood shakes, and rubber roofing,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.
How can I tell if my barn roof needs replacement? Indicators include persistent leaks, extensive rust or rot, missing or damaged shingles, and visible sagging or structural issues.
Are there any permits required for barn roof replacement? Permit requirements depend on local regulations; contacting local contractors can help determine if permits are necessary.
What should I consider when choosing a contractor for barn roof replacement? It's important to evaluate their experience, reputation, and ability to work with various roofing materials, as well as obtaining multiple quotes for comparison.
